A selection-based search system is a search engine system in which the user invokes a search query using only the mouse. [1] A selection-based search system allows the user to search the internet for more information about any keyword or phrase contained within a document or webpage in any software application on their desktop computer using the mouse.
Traditional browser-based search systems require the user to launch a web browser, navigate to a search page, type or paste a query into a search box, review a list of results, and click a hyperlink to view these results. Three characteristic features of a selection-based search system are that the user can invoke search using only their mouse from within the context of any application on their desktop (for example Microsoft Office, Adobe Reader, Mozilla Firefox, etc.), receive categorized suggestions which are based on the context of the user-selected text (or in some cases the wisdom of crowds), and view the results in floating information boxes which can be sized, shared, docked, closed and stacked on top of the document that has the user’s primary focus.
In its simplest form, selection-based search enables users to launch a search query by selecting text on any application on their desktop. It is commonly believed that selection-based search lowers the user barrier to search and permits an incremental number of searches per user per day. [2] Selection-based search systems also operate on the premise that users value information in context. They may save the user from having to juggle multiple applications, multiple web browsers or use multiple search engines separately. [3]
The term selection-based search is frequently used to classify a set of search engine systems, including a desktop client and a series of cloud computing services, but is also used to describe the paradigm of categorizing a keyword and searching multiple data sources using only the mouse. The National Information Standards Organization (NISO) uses the terms selection-based search and mouse-based search interchangeably to describe this web search paradigm.
Selection-based search systems create what is known as a semantic database of trained terms. They do not compile a physical database or catalogue of the web on the users' desktop computer. Instead, they take a user's selected keyword or keywords, pass it to several heterogeneous online cloud services, categorize the keyword(s), and then compile the results in a homogeneous manner based on a specific algorithm. [4]
No two selection-based search systems are alike. Some simply provide a list of links in a context menu to other websites, such as the proposed Internet Explorer 8 Accelerators feature. Others only allow the user to search their desktop files such as Macintosh Spotlight, or to search a popular search engine such as Google or Yahoo!, while others only search lesser-known search engines, newsgroups, and more specialized databases. Selection-based search systems also differ in how the results are presented and the quality of semantic categorization which is used. Some will open links to content in a new browser window. Others return content in floating information boxes which can be sized, shared, docked, etc.
A key challenge for selection-based search is that a long or nested list of categories quickly becomes unwieldy for the user. Therefore, it is incumbent upon the selection-based search system to both categorize the user-selected text and to identify those online services which most naturally apply to the selected text. For example, when the user selects an address, the system needs to identify the address as most suitable for an online mapping service such as Google Maps. When the user selects a movie title, the system needs to identify the selection as suitable for a movie database such as Internet Movie Database. When the user selects the name of a company, the system needs to identify the concordant stock symbol and an appropriate financial database such as Yahoo! Finance.
Usability can vary widely between selection-based search systems relying on a large number of variables. Even the most basic selection-based search systems will allow more of the web to be searched by the user in the context of their work than any one stand-alone search engine. On the other hand, the process is sometimes said to be redundant if the system applies no intelligence to categorizing the selected text and matching it to an online service, and simply provides a link for the user to their preferred search engine(s).
Microsoft Access is a database management system (DBMS) from Microsoft that combines the relational Access Database Engine (ACE) with a graphical user interface and software-development tools. It is a member of the Microsoft 365 suite of applications, included in the Professional and higher editions or sold separately.
Internet research is the practice of using Internet information, especially free information on the World Wide Web, or Internet-based resources in research.
File Explorer, previously known as Windows Explorer, is a file manager application and default desktop environment that is included with releases of the Microsoft Windows operating system from Windows 95 onwards. It provides a graphical user interface for accessing the file systems, as well as user interface elements such as the taskbar and desktop.
A Rich Internet Application is a web application that has many of the characteristics of desktop application software. The concept is closely related to a single-page application, and may allow the user interactive features such as drag and drop, background menu, WYSIWYG editing, etc. The concept was first introduced in 2002 by Macromedia to describe Macromedia Flash MX product. Throughout the 2000s, the term was generalized to describe browser-based applications developed with other competing browser plugin technologies including Java applets, Microsoft Silverlight.
Desktop search tools search within a user's own computer files as opposed to searching the Internet. These tools are designed to find information on the user's PC, including web browser history, e-mail archives, text documents, sound files, images, and video. A variety of desktop search programs are now available; see this list for examples. Most desktop search programs are standalone applications. Desktop search products are software alternatives to the search software included in the operating system, helping users sift through desktop files, emails, attachments, and more.
In text retrieval, full-text search refers to techniques for searching a single computer-stored document or a collection in a full-text database. Full-text search is distinguished from searches based on metadata or on parts of the original texts represented in databases.
Yahoo! Search is a search engine owned and operated by Yahoo!, using Microsoft Bing to power results.
In computing, a news aggregator, also termed a feed aggregator, content aggregator, feed reader, news reader, or simply an aggregator, is client software or a web application that aggregates digital content such as online newspapers, blogs, podcasts, and video blogs (vlogs) in one location for easy viewing. The updates distributed may include journal tables of contents, podcasts, videos, and news items.
An IFilter is a plugin that allows Microsoft's search engines to index various file formats so that they become searchable. Without an appropriate IFilter, contents of a file cannot be parsed and indexed by the search engine.
Compared with previous versions of Microsoft Windows, features new to Windows Vista are numerous, covering most aspects of the operating system, including additional management features, new aspects of security and safety, new I/O technologies, new networking features, and new technical features. Windows Vista also removed some others.
A search engine is a software system that provides hyperlinks to web pages and other relevant information on the Web in response to a user's query. The user inputs a query within a web browser or a mobile app, and the search results are often a list of hyperlinks, accompanied by textual summaries and images. Users also have the option of limiting the search to a specific type of results, such as images, videos, or news.
This article details features of the Opera web browser.
In Internet marketing, search advertising is a method of placing online advertisements on web pages that show results from search engine queries. Through the same search-engine advertising services, ads can also be placed on Web pages with other published content.
Smart tags are an early selection-based search feature, found in later versions of Microsoft Word and beta versions of the Internet Explorer 6 web browser, by which the application recognizes certain words or types of data and converts it to a hyperlink. It is also included in other Microsoft Office programs as well as Visual Web Developer. Selection-based search allows a user to invoke an online service from any other page using only the mouse. Microsoft had initially intended the technology to be built into its Windows XP operating system but changed its plans due to public criticism.
Microsoft SQL Server is a proprietary relational database management system developed by Microsoft. As a database server, it is a software product with the primary function of storing and retrieving data as requested by other software applications—which may run either on the same computer or on another computer across a network. Microsoft markets at least a dozen different editions of Microsoft SQL Server, aimed at different audiences and for workloads ranging from small single-machine applications to large Internet-facing applications with many concurrent users.
Windows Search is a content index and desktop search platform by Microsoft introduced in Windows Vista as a replacement for the previous Indexing Service of Windows 2000, Windows XP, and Windows Server 2003, designed to facilitate local and remote queries for files and non-file items in the Windows Shell and in compatible applications. It was developed after the postponement of WinFS and introduced to Windows several benefits of that platform.
Natural-language user interface is a type of computer human interface where linguistic phenomena such as verbs, phrases and clauses act as UI controls for creating, selecting and modifying data in software applications.
Reverse image search is a content-based image retrieval (CBIR) query technique that involves providing the CBIR system with a sample image that it will then base its search upon; in terms of information retrieval, the sample image is very useful. In particular, reverse image search is characterized by a lack of search terms. This effectively removes the need for a user to guess at keywords or terms that may or may not return a correct result. Reverse image search also allows users to discover content that is related to a specific sample image or the popularity of an image, and to discover manipulated versions and derivative works.
Accelerators were a form of selection-based search allowing a user to invoke an online service from any other page using only the mouse; they were introduced by Microsoft in Internet Explorer 8. Actions such as selecting the text or other objects gave users access to the usable Accelerator services, which could then be invoked with the selected object. According to Microsoft, Accelerators eliminated the need to copy and paste content between web pages. IE 8 specified an XML-based encoding which allowed a web application or web service to be invoked as an Accelerator service. How the service would be invoked and for what categories of content it would show up were specified in the XML file. Similarities have been drawn between Accelerators and the controversial smart tags feature experimented with in the IE 6 Beta but withdrawn after criticism.
Multimodal search is a type of search that uses different methods to get relevant results. They can use any kind of search, search by keyword, search by concept, search by example, etc.